Financial markets have dramatically shifted their expectations for Federal Reserve policy following the release of a hotter-than-anticipated inflation report. Pricing in interest rate futures now suggests virtually no chance of a rate cut through at least 2027, and traders have begun to factor in the possibility of a rate hike instead.

Market pricing in federal funds futures has undergone a significant repricing after the latest inflation data exceeded consensus estimates. According to data from the CME Group’s FedWatch tool, the probability of any rate reduction between now and the end of 2027 has collapsed to near zero. In contrast, odds of a rate increase over the same period have risen, though they remain below 50%. The shift follows the release of the Consumer Price Index (CPI) for the month of February, which showed a year-over-year increase that surpassed economists’ forecasts. Core inflation, which excludes volatile food and energy categories, also came in stronger than anticipated. The report reignited concerns that inflationary pressures are proving stickier than the central bank had hoped. Economists noted that the data could force the Federal Open Market Committee (FOMC) to maintain — or even tighten — monetary policy for longer. The current federal funds rate stands at a range of 5.25%–5.50%, where it has remained since July 2023. Market participants now see a growing chance that the next move by the Fed might be upward rather than downward.

Key takeaways from the market reaction center on the dramatic collapse of rate cut expectations. Just a few months ago, futures pricing indicated a strong likelihood of multiple cuts beginning as early as mid-2025. That timeline has now been pushed back indefinitely. The inflation data suggests that the Fed’s preferred measure, the Personal Consumption Expenditures (PCE) price index, could also come in above target in coming months. If that occurs, the central bank could be compelled to acknowledge that its current policy stance is not sufficiently restrictive. Market sectors sensitive to interest rates, such as real estate, utilities, and small-cap stocks, have experienced heightened volatility. Treasury yields rose sharply following the CPI release, with the 10-year note yield climbing approximately 10 basis points in a single trading session. Higher borrowing costs could weigh on corporate investment and consumer spending in the months ahead.

From an investment perspective, the shifting Fed outlook presents several potential implications. If a rate hike materializes, it would mark a reversal from the broadly expected easing cycle and could trigger a broader reassessment of asset valuations. Equities might face headwinds, particularly growth stocks that are sensitive to discount rate assumptions. Bond investors may need to adjust duration positioning, as a prolonged period of higher rates could lead to further flattening of the yield curve. Meanwhile, sectors such as financials could benefit from a steeper curve if the Fed tightens further. However, it remains uncertain whether the inflation data represents a temporary setback or the start of a sustained trend. The Fed has emphasized its data-dependent approach, and upcoming reports on employment, producer prices, and consumer spending would likely influence the next policy decision.
